The food item associated with B.cereus emetic food-type poisoning is:

Correct Answer: Fried rice
Description: Option 1, 4 Food items associated: Diarrheal type - Meat, vegetables, dried beans, cereals. Emetic type - Rice (Chinese fried rice). 1. Bacillus cereus food poisoning is of two types. Emetic type and Diarrheal type abdominal cramps are common features in both. Other features are: a) Emetic Type: History of intake of fried rice from Chinese restaurant 6 hour earlier. Mediated by enterotoxin resembling E. coli stable toxin. On ingestion of the rice, the toxin causes nausea, vomiting, and abdominal cramps after a sho incubation period of 6 hours. Diarrhea and fever are rare. b) Diarrhoeal type: History of intake of cooked meat and vegetables 8-16 hours earlier. Mediated by enterotoxin resembling E. coli.The symptoms consist of acute abdominal pain, diarrhea, and nausea; vomiting is rare Option 2, 3 Brucellosisis: Ingestion of raw milk or dairy products. Staphylococcal food poisoning: Most common food items involved are milk products, bakery food, custards, potato salad, or processed meats. BOTULISM:-Food borne botulism occurs due to preformed toxin mixed with canned food.
